What Is Respiratory Care & Oxygen Therapy?

Respiratory Care and Oxygen Therapy encompass a critical set of medical interventions designed to diagnose, treat, and manage acute and chronic cardiopulmonary conditions. These therapies focus on optimizing lung function, ensuring adequate oxygenation of the body's tissues, and improving patients' overall quality of life. In the context of Burkina Faso, where respiratory illnesses can represent a significant public health burden, these services are essential for preventing complications, reducing mortality, and enabling patients to recover and maintain independence.

At its core, respiratory care involves the assessment and treatment of breathing disorders through the use of various modalities. Oxygen therapy, a fundamental component, delivers supplemental oxygen to individuals whose bodies are not receiving sufficient amounts through normal respiration. This is vital for conditions that impair the lungs' ability to transfer oxygen from the air into the bloodstream.

  • Diagnosis: Utilizing tools like spirometry, pulse oximetry, and arterial blood gas analysis to identify respiratory problems.
  • Treatment: Administering inhaled medications (bronchodilators, corticosteroids), performing chest physiotherapy, and providing ventilatory support (non-invasive and invasive).
  • Oxygen Delivery: Supplying medical-grade oxygen via nasal cannulas, masks, or more advanced delivery systems to maintain adequate oxygen saturation levels.
  • Patient Education & Monitoring: Empowering patients and caregivers with knowledge about their condition and treatment, alongside continuous monitoring of vital signs and respiratory status.

Who Needs Respiratory Care & Oxygen Therapy In Burkina Faso?

A wide spectrum of healthcare facilities and departments across Burkina Faso are critical in providing respiratory care and oxygen therapy. The need extends from complex tertiary care settings to primary healthcare points, ensuring that every patient with breathing difficulties receives timely and appropriate intervention.

  • Teaching Hospitals and Referral Centers: These advanced facilities are equipped to handle the most severe and complex respiratory conditions, including ch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) exacerbations, severe pneumonia, ac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S), and neonatal respiratory distress. They require a comprehensive range of ventilators, oxygen concentrators, cylinders, and specialized monitoring equipment.
  • Regional and District Hospitals: Serving as crucial intermediate care hubs, these hospitals manage a high volume of respiratory illnesses, including community-acquired pneumonia, asthma attacks, and tuberculosis (TB) requiring oxygen support. They need reliable oxygen supply systems (concentrators and cylinders) and basic respiratory support devices.
  • Health Centers and Rural Clinics: These frontline facilities play a vital role in early detection and management of respiratory infections like malaria-induced pneumonia, common childhood respiratory illnesses, and acute exacerbations of chronic conditions. They are essential for providing basic oxygen therapy, nebulizers, and essential medications to prevent severe outcomes and reduce the burden on higher-level facilities.
  • Pediatric Departments: Across all facility types, pediatric departments are paramount. Children are particularly vulnerable to respiratory infections, and specialized equipment and trained personnel are needed for pediatric ventilation, oxygen delivery devices (e.g., nasal cannulas, masks designed for infants), and continuous monitoring.
  • Maternal and Child Health (MCH) Units: Within these units, particularly in maternity wards and neonatal intensive care units (NICUs), oxygen therapy is indispensable for managing birth asphyxia, prematurity-related respiratory issues, and neonatal pneumonia.
  • Emergency Departments and Intensive Care Units (ICUs): Regardless of the facility's size, the ER and ICU are critical points for immediate respiratory support. Patients presenting with acute respiratory failure, sepsis, severe trauma, or during surgical recovery often require immediate oxygen therapy and mechanical ventilation.
  • Tuberculosis (TB) Wards: While TB treatment focuses on antimicrobial therapy, patients with advanced or complicated TB can develop significant respiratory compromise requiring supplemental oxygen, especially during exacerbations or co-infections.

How Much Is A Respiratory Care & Oxygen Therapy In Burkina Faso?

The cost of respiratory care and oxygen therapy in Burkina Faso can vary significantly based on several factors, including the specific treatment required, the duration of therapy, the type of equipment used, and the healthcare facility. While precise figures are not readily available due to the diverse nature of services and fluctuating market conditions, we can offer a general overview of potential cost ranges in local currency (CFA franc).

For basic oxygen therapy, such as the provision of oxygen cylinders for home use or short-term hospital stays, individuals might expect costs ranging from approximately 15,000 CFA to 50,000 CFA. This typically includes the rental or purchase of the oxygen concentrator or cylinder, a certain amount of oxygen, and potentially basic consumables like nasal cannulas.

More complex respiratory care services, which might involve specialized equipment like ventilators, CPAP/BiPAP machines, or intensive respiratory physiotherapy, will naturally incur higher costs. These can range from 75,000 CFA to over 250,000 CFA, and in cases requiring extended hospital stays or advanced life support, the total expenditure could be considerably more. Factors such as the need for trained respiratory therapists, ongoing monitoring, and consumable supplies (filters, tubing, masks) contribute to these higher price points.

It's important to note that these are indicative ranges. The actual cost will be determined by a consultation with a healthcare provider in Burkina Faso who can assess the patient's specific needs and provide a detailed quotation. Accessibility and affordability remain key considerations, and efforts are ongoing to make these essential services more widely available across the country.
